> > > +   this group of pins in this pin configuration node are working on.
> > > +3. The driver can use the function node's name and pin configuration node's
> > > +   name describe the pin function and group hierarchy.
> > > +   For example, Linux IMX pinctrl driver takes the function node's name
> > > +   as the function name and pin configuration node's name as group name to
> > > +   create the map table.
> > > +4. Each pin configuration node should have a phandle, devices can set pins
> > > +   configurations by referring to the phandle of that pin configuration node.
> > > +
> > > +Examples:
> > > +usdhc@...9c000 { /* uSDHC4 */
> > > +	fsl,card-wired;
> > > +	vmmc-supply = <&reg_3p3v>;
> > > +	status = "okay";
> > > +	pinctrl-names = "default";
> > > +	pinctrl-0 = <&pinctrl_usdhc4_1>;
> > > +};
> > > +
> > > +iomuxc@...e0000 {
> > > +	compatible = "fsl,imx6q-iomuxc";
> > > +	reg = <0x020e0000 0x4000>;
> > > +
> > > +	/* shared pinctrl settings */
> > > +	usdhc4 {
> > > +		pinctrl_usdhc4_1: usdhc4grp-1 {
> > > +			fsl,pins = <1386 0x17059	/* MX6Q_PAD_SD4_CMD__USDHC4_CMD */
> > > +				    1392 0x17059	/* MX6Q_PAD_SD4_CLK__USDHC4_CLK	*/
> > > +				    1462 0x17059	/* MX6Q_PAD_SD4_DAT0__USDHC4_DAT0 */
> > > +				    1470 0x17059	/* MX6Q_PAD_SD4_DAT1__USDHC4_DAT1 */
> > > +				    1478 0x17059	/* MX6Q_PAD_SD4_DAT2__USDHC4_DAT2 */
> > > +				    1486 0x17059	/* MX6Q_PAD_SD4_DAT3__USDHC4_DAT3 */
> > > +				    1493 0x17059	/* MX6Q_PAD_SD4_DAT4__USDHC4_DAT4 */
> > > +				    1501 0x17059	/* MX6Q_PAD_SD4_DAT5__USDHC4_DAT5 */
> > > +				    1509 0x17059	/* MX6Q_PAD_SD4_DAT6__USDHC4_DAT6 */
> > > +				    1517 0x17059>;	/* MX6Q_PAD_SD4_DAT7__USDHC4_DAT7 */
